  Description

  BASIC FUNCTIONThe Financial Wellness Coach (FWC) in the Women of Wealth Program, the primary role is to guide and educate participants in improving their financial well-being and achieving entrepreneurial goals. A Financial Wellness Coach will teach essential entrepreneurial skills, money management, financial literacy, and technology's role in finance to enhance generational wealth. Working closely with participants, the FWC will assess their financial situation, identify areas for improvement, and create personalized strategies for effective money management, stress reduction, and long-term financial security planning. This role requires a strong understanding of personal finance, budgeting, saving, investing, and debt management, as well as excellent communication and coaching skills. The goal of a FWC in the Women of Wealth Program is to empower women towards financial independence and entrepreneurial success.J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IESA.  Deliver comprehensive financial education courses and workshops, focusing on entrepreneurial skills, effective money management, financial literacy, and the use of technology in finance. Must be able to present complex financial concepts in a clear and accessible manner for customers with varying levels of financial knowledge.B.  Assist in the development and enhancement of the program's financial education curriculum to meet the specific needs of the participants. Create educational materials, resources, and tools to enhance clients' financial literacy.C.  Monitor and track participants' progress towards their financial and entrepreneurial goals, providing feedback and adjustments as needed. Conduct one-on-one coaching sessions with participants to assess their financial situations, identify goals, and create personalized financial plans. Provide actionable strategies and recommendations to improve financial habits and achieve financial goals. Responsible for maintaining and monitoring a caseload of participants to provide ongoing financial guidance and support.D.  Foster a positive and supportive environment for participants, encouraging active engagement and participation in the program. Assist participants in understanding their financial strengths and weaknesses. Address participant's concerns, questions, and uncertainties about personal finance matters.E.  Have knowledge of, and the ability to utilize technology for meeting, presenting, documenting, and marketing purposes.F.  Assists in representing GKA and the program at relevant meetings in the community. Provide outreach services to the community at large regarding WoW's purpose.G.  Create a business plan and can teach and connect people with resources for third party reselling.
